Businesses are adding AI to existing applications rather than building models from scratch. We build the Node.js API and orchestration layer that connects applications to OpenAI, Azure OpenAI, and Anthropic APIs: retrieval-augmented generation pipelines that ground AI responses in the business’s own data, AI chatbots integrated into existing customer-facing applications, and automated agent workflows that execute multi-step tasks. Node.js’s async architecture handles the variable latency of AI API calls without blocking other application requests.
SaaS is the strongest commercial Node.js opportunity because the platform’s API-first, horizontally scalable architecture matches exactly what multi-tenant software needs. We build multi-tenant SaaS backends with proper data isolation between customers, subscription billing through Stripe or usage-based billing for consumption models, role-based access control for different user types within a customer account, and the admin dashboards that let the SaaS provider manage the platform. CRM, ERP, HR software, and industry-specific SaaS all follow this same architectural foundation.
Almost every modern application needs an API layer, which makes this one of the most broadly applicable Node.js services. We design REST and GraphQL APIs with clear contracts, build backend-for-frontend layers that serve web and mobile clients from tailored endpoints, and modernise legacy APIs that were never designed for the integration volume they now handle. Third-party API integration, from payment gateways to AI services to CRM platforms, is a routine part of nearly every Node.js engagement.
Node.js’s event-driven architecture makes it a natural fit for applications where information needs to move quickly between users and systems. We build chat and messaging systems, live dashboards showing real-time data updates, delivery and fleet tracking applications, collaborative tools where multiple users edit the same content simultaneously, and trading dashboards processing high-frequency data streams. WebSockets and Server-Sent Events handle the persistent connections these applications require without the overhead of constant polling.
Large organisations increasingly break large applications into independently deployable services, and Node.js’s lightweight footprint suits this pattern well. We design microservice boundaries around business domains, implement event-driven communication through Kafka, RabbitMQ, or Redis rather than tightly coupled direct service calls, and manage the migration path from an existing monolith to a microservices architecture without a disruptive big-bang rewrite. Docker and Kubernetes handle containerisation and orchestration for the resulting distributed system.
Node.js is increasingly the middleware layer behind sophisticated ecommerce experiences, particularly for connecting Shopify, WooCommerce, or Magento to external systems. We build the Node.js integration layer that syncs inventory, orders, and customer data between a commerce platform and an ERP or CRM system in real time, headless commerce backends that serve custom storefronts, and multi-vendor marketplace platforms with the order routing and vendor management logic that a single-vendor commerce platform does not provide natively.
FinTech is a strong Node.js use case because of its need for APIs, real-time events, and third-party integrations. We build payment platform backends, digital wallet applications, and banking API integrations covering open banking connectivity and transaction data. Real-time transaction monitoring and fraud detection systems process transaction events as they happen rather than in batch, using Node.js’s event-driven model to flag suspicious activity within the transaction flow rather than after the fact.
Companies often do not want a completely new system. They want to modernise what they have. We migrate ageing PHP applications and legacy frameworks to Node.js, restructure tightly coupled monoliths into API-first architectures that support modern frontend frameworks and mobile applications, and pair legacy business logic with a modern Node.js API layer that lets the rest of the system evolve without a full rewrite. This is positioned as a modernisation project with a defined migration path, not a ground-up rebuild.
Node.js works extensively with modern cloud infrastructure. We build serverless APIs on AWS Lambda, Azure Functions, and Google Cloud Functions for workloads with variable or unpredictable traffic where auto-scaling and pay-per-execution pricing reduce infrastructure cost. For applications needing persistent processes, Docker and Kubernetes handle containerisation and orchestration for cloud-native Node.js services. Event-driven cloud architecture connects these components so the system scales automatically with demand rather than requiring manual capacity planning.
Node.js is well suited to applications where large numbers of devices need to communicate with backend services. We build IoT backends for smart home platforms, fleet tracking, industrial equipment monitoring, and logistics systems, using MQTT for lightweight device-to-backend communication and processing high-volume sensor data streams in real time. IoT dashboards give operators visibility into device status and performance, and predictive maintenance systems flag equipment issues before they cause downtime based on sensor data patterns.
Commerce platforms rarely operate in isolation from the rest of the business. We build the Node.js middleware layer that connects Shopify, WooCommerce, and Magento stores to NetSuite, SAGE, Salesforce, and warehouse management systems, using webhooks and event-driven architecture so inventory, order, and customer data stay synchronised across systems in near real time. This is the integration layer that turns a standalone commerce platform into part of a connected operation, and it is a natural extension for businesses already working with our eCommerce practice.
